"Satin" is a smooth fabric, such as of silk or rayon, woven with a glossy face and a dull back, whereas "Sateen" is a strong cotton fabric constructed in a satin weave and has a lustrous face. Sateen produces the sheen and softer feel through the use of a different structure in the weaving process. The sateen structure is four over, one under, placing the most threads on the surface, making it extremely soft, though slightly less durable than other weaves. Standard, non-sateen, weaves use a one over, one under structure. Satin also uses this structure, however, instead of using cotton, different materials are used, such as silk, polyester, etc.
